There were mourning screams and cries being heard everywhere. Widows and orphans of those who martyred displayed their heartfelt emotions presenting a really moving picture for any onlooker. They all had gathered to perform water rites for those left them after disastrous war.
At a distance from there, he watched and felt the pain in those cries tearing him apart. What he lost and what he gained, it was difficult to assess .Even though Yudhisthir had won the war, he was a defeated man standing with head held in shame and remorse.
Yudhisthir had stayed back after his brothers and Mother Kunti left from river shore where they did water rites of their kin and one name in those prayers was of his elder brother whose existence he had just got to know and tragedy was that very existence was no more.
He was feeling worn out after crying out his heart out on the loss and cursing his mother for fate of her first born. He felt like someone snatched away his soul and teared it apart into thousand pieces and what remained was a dead man watching his life slowly going away. It was hard to accept for him that just a day ago he was rejoicing his own elder brother's death as they knew victory was certain once Karna was gone. Before his death, he had spared Yudhisthir's life. He recounted the events at battlefield when he was on the very edge of Karna's aim. They say that he never misses any aim. But he missed that day. Was it only his promise to their mother or his brotherly love? Unanswered questions bothering Yudhisthir even more this time.
Why Mother? Why? ... He barely whispered to himself.
He looked back in time at one such memory of a night between him and his brother. The night where he actually felt he had him by his side as his Jyesth. He could now comprehend each emotion that he saw in Karna's eyes, every bit of it... Yudhisthir now knew that Karna had known the truth just before the war.
He recalled his words to his elder brother I have always looked up to you as my elder brother, now every emotion that Karna felt could be felt by him too. He had often wondered what made Karna stay with him that night. He wished Karna would have just embraced him once that night. They both would have cried at their fate together. He would have given everything up for his Jyesth perhaps that is the reason Karna never revealed to him. He looked at the setting sun near horizon with many complaints. Sun appeared gloomy that evening, it was slowly disappearing among those clouds beneath.
Ahh Jyesth, I wish I too had known.. I would have touched those feet that night...I wish you would have held me in your arms like your child. With those words aloud, he bend down on his knees as Sun filled the sky with its last glorious cry ..
